MARGAO, Feb. 6 -- Team Herald

NGO Bailancho Ekvott on Thursday urged the police to thoroughly investigate the child abuse case reported at Tivim railway station and take strict action against the accused.

Auda Viegas, President of Bailancho Ekvott, said the organisation spoke to the child and his mother, who revealed disturbing details about the alleged perpetrator.

According to Viegas, the accused would frequently pick up the child, take him home, and make him watch inappropriate videos, a clear violation of the Goa Children's

Act, 2023.

"The individual would take the child on his bike, bring him home, and even place him on his shoulders to pick fruits," Viegas stated.
